Dr Maurizio Nava is Majored in Oncology, General Surgery and Plastic Reconstructive and Aesthetic Surgery and Honorary Chairman at the G.RE.TA, Group of Reconstructive and Therapeutic Advancements, Milan Italy. He achieved his Bachelor of Medicine and Surgery at the University of Milan in 1977. He went on to specialize in oncology in 1980 and general surgery in 1986. In 1993, he then specialized in plastic and reconstructive surgery. Since graduating, he has worked at the National Institute for the Study and Treatment of Cancer in Milan, where he held the position of Director of the Plastic Unit from 1997 till 2014. As Adjunct Professor – School of Specialization in Plastic Surgery, University of Milan and Genova, he participates in national and international studies on implants, ADMs, fat cells and microsurgical flaps in oncoplastic breast surgery. He is Honorary President of the G.RE.TA, a Foundation, which works on updates to the international multidisciplinary field of oncoplastic, reconstructive and aesthetic breast surgery, support clinical researches and studies and operates a forum for exchange of ideas with patients. He is author and co-author of more than 200 publications in Italian, English and Spanish on oncological , reconstruction and aesthetic breast surgery, 5 books as author and several chapters in other books. He has organized several international conferences on both reconstructive and aesthetic surgery of the breast. He and his team are dedicated to oncoplastic, reconstructive and cosmetic surgery of the breast.
